Singapore PHP Developer Salary Guide 2026
| Experience Level | Monthly Salary (SGD) | Annual Salary (SGD) | Equivalent US Rate |
|---|---|---|---|
| Junior (1-3 years) | $3,000-$4,000 | $36,000-$48,000 | $8,000-$10,000/month |
| Mid-level (3-5 years) | $4,000-$6,000 | $48,000-$72,000 | $10,000-$14,000/month |
| Senior (5-8 years) | $6,000-$12,000 | $72,000-$144,000 | $14,000-$18,000/month |
| Lead/Principal (8+ years) | $12,000+ | $144,000+ | $18,000+/month |
Singapore rates reflect the 2x premium due to high living costs and competitive market demand. These Second Talent rates represent actual market data from 2026 placements.

Singapore-Specific Development Considerations
Integration Requirements
Singapore developers must understand local payment systems. PayNow integration requires specific API knowledge and security considerations.
Singpass authentication is mandatory for government-related applications. Developers need experience with OAuth flows and identity verification.
We helped a healthcare startup integrate with Singapore's national health database. The project required specialized knowledge of local compliance requirements.
Compliance and Security
Personal Data Protection Act (PDPA) compliance shapes development practices. Developers must implement proper data handling, storage, and deletion procedures.
Financial applications follow Monetary Authority of Singapore (MAS) guidelines. Security requirements include encryption, audit trails, and access controls.
Multi-currency support is essential for regional expansion. Applications must handle SGD, USD, and various Asian currencies with proper exchange rate handling.

Interview Process for PHP Developers
Technical Assessment
Start with a practical coding challenge using Laravel or Symfony. Real-world scenarios work better than algorithmic puzzles for PHP roles.
Code review exercises reveal architectural thinking. Present candidates with existing code and ask for improvement suggestions.
API development tasks test essential skills. Most Singapore PHP roles involve building or consuming RESTful APIs.
Singapore-Specific Questions
Ask about experience with local payment systems. Candidates should understand PayNow, NETS, and major bank APIs.
Inquire about PDPA compliance implementation. Proper data handling knowledge is crucial for Singapore-based applications.
Discuss multi-currency and internationalization requirements. Regional expansion plans require developers who understand these challenges.
Employment Laws and Regulations
Work Pass Requirements
Employment Pass (EP) is required for foreign PHP developers earning above $5,000 monthly. The application process takes 1-3 weeks with proper documentation.
S Pass covers developers earning $3,000-$5,000 monthly. Companies must maintain specific ratios of local to foreign workers.
Tech.Pass provides a new option for experienced developers. This program targets senior talent and offers more flexibility.
Employment Terms
Standard employment contracts include 14 days annual leave plus public holidays. Singapore observes 11 public holidays annually.
Notice periods typically range from 1-3 months depending on seniority. Senior developers often negotiate longer notice periods.
Central Provident Fund (CPF) contributions are mandatory for Singapore citizens and permanent residents. Foreign workers on work passes are generally exempt.
